Suspension for Non-Payment of Fees and Reinstatement

Late Submission Penalty​
College of Medical Laboratory Technologists of Ontario (CMLTO) registrants are required to pay an annual registration renewal fee by December 31st of each year. Payments made after December 31st are subject to penalty fees. The fee penalties are detailed below.​

Notice of Intention to Suspend​

If a registrant fails to pay their annual registration renewal fee by December 31st , the Registrar & CEO will provide the registrant a notice of intention to suspend their certificate of registration. Thirty days (30) after notice is given, the Registrar & CEO may suspend the registrant's certificate of registration for failure to pay the required fees.

Suspension of Certificate of Registration​
If a registrant's certificate of registration is suspended, the Registrar & CEO will notify the registrant and any employers by mail. Upon suspension, the certificate of registration expires, and the former registrant is no longer authorized to practise medical laboratory technology in Ontario. A permanent notation of the suspension will appear on the CMLTO's public register. Annually, CMLTO publishes a list of all suspended registrants in the FOCUS newsletter.

Reinstatement​
A person whose certificate of registration was suspended may apply to the Registrar & CEO for reinstatement of their registration any time within three (3) years from the suspension date. If the suspension is not lifted within three (3) years, the certificate of registration shall be revoked.
